Solar Reserve (Tonopah, Nevada) 2014 is a computer simulation of a historic power plant known as a solar thermal power tower, surrounded by 10,000 mirrors that reflect sunlight upon it to heat molten salts, forming a thermal battery used to generate electricity. Over the course of a 365–day year, the work simulates the actual movements of the sun, moon, and stars across the sky, as they would appear at the Nevada site, with the thousands of mirrors adjusting their positions in real time according to the position of the sun. This virtual world was constructed by the artist, a team of modelers, and programmers, using a simulation engine. Simultaneously over a 24–hour period the point of view will cycle from ground level to a satellite view every 60 minutes, creating an elaborate choreography among perspectives, 10,000 turning mirrors, and an interplay of light and shadow. Solar Reserve is no longer operational. It was a first-of-a-kind solar project, federally underwritten but technically defeated by ecological failures, storage-tank metallurgy and operationally outpaced by parallel PV cost drops. These hyper sped ecological, technical and political cycles leave now only a still-standing cement tower in the desert alongside this detailed virtual record. The artwork is a real-time software simulation, not a video. Built on a game engine, it generates every frame live at approximately 50 frames per second, with no two moments ever repeating. The simulation is locked to the computer's clock: the sun rises and sets at the exact times it would at the depicted location, and day lengths shift with the seasons across a full 365-day cycle. To own and display the work, the collector downloads and runs this software on a local PC. Solar Reserve (Tonopah, Nevada) 2014 exists in a fixed and immutable edition of 5 + 2 artist's proofs (AP). The edition was established in 2014 and is not expanded or altered by tokenization. Each edition is accompanied by a paper based certificate of authenticity or a blockchain art token on the Ethereum network, which serves as the on-chain certificate of authenticity and proof of ownership for that edition. This token is represented on-chain by a proofing still image stored on Ethereum. A 2132 x 1600 video proof compresses one day of the simulation from pre-dawn to dusk into a single viewing, revealing the work's time-bound behaviour as the light shifts across the full arc of the day. Neither the still nor the video proof constitutes the artwork. The online archive of the work is sustained into perpetuity by the john gerrard estate. Solar Reserve (Tonopah, Nevada) 2014 is part of the collection of The Museum of Modern Art, New York (Gift of the VIA Art Fund) and Los Angeles County Museum of Art (Purchased with funds provided by Leonardo DiCaprio).
